Metric Api: checking paranoid mode during zeInit

Change-Id: I9e53f5707a959a6a2f598995495c484b72ff1931
This commit is contained in:
Piotr Maciejewski
2020-08-06 14:27:05 +02:00
committed by sys_ocldev
parent a34ee242d9
commit c3790388b8
7 changed files with 149 additions and 4 deletions

View File

@@ -155,7 +155,7 @@ void MetricsLibrary::initialize() {
// Metrics Enumeration needs to be initialized before Metrics Library
const bool validMetricsEnumeration = metricsEnumeration.isInitialized();
const bool validMetricsLibrary = validMetricsEnumeration && metricContext.isInitialized() && createContext();
const bool validMetricsLibrary = validMetricsEnumeration && handle && createContext();
// Load metrics library and exported functions.
initializationState = validMetricsLibrary ? ZE_RESULT_SUCCESS : ZE_RESULT_ERROR_UNKNOWN;